A man has been left in critical condition after he was shot at a local hotel. Colton police officials were dispatched to the Rodeway Inn Hotel at about 10:20 p.m. Tuesday, May 5, where they located the victim, identified by police as a 20-year-old black male, who had been shot in the upper abdominal area. The victim was immediately taken to Loma Linda University Medical Center, where he is currently listed in critical care, said police. A release issued by Colton police officials stated that the suspect was no longer at the scene when they arrived. Corporal Ray Mendez said via email that police are still in the early stages of investigation and what led to the shooting. Investigators believe there may have been an altercation or a disagreement between the victim and the suspect in one of the hotel rooms before the shooting occurred.
